Worlds strongest man results 2007


posts: 16
 
Bigbaldski
Edited by: Bigbaldski  Jan 4, 08, 15:26  #1

1.)Mariusz Pudzianowski
2.)Sebastian Wenta
3.)Terry Holland
4.)Phil Pfister

Yes the mighty Mariusz has won his fourth title and Wenta took second so 1st and 2nd to Poland and 3rd to England!!Everybodys happy!!!!
